Disturbia rouses the US box office

You are a film executive. You’ve just completed a movie that stars not only Halle Berry’s sexy body but also Bruce Willis. It’s a steamy thriller with an Internet hook. “Ah,” you think to yourself, as you sit back, light a cigar made of money and reach for a roasted puppy, “I shall win the box office and that little teen-centric remake of Rear Window… what’s it called, Sublurbia... will perish! Muhahahahahaaa!” Well, someone is laughing on the other side of their well nipped and mightily tucked face this morning as the little thriller that could – better known as Disturbia, and featuring rising star Shia LaBeouf - handily won the weekend with a healthy estimated $23 million.

That means skating comedy Blades Of Glory had to drop to second place, but don’t cry for Paramount/DreamWorks: the weekend’s result means they have the top two films in the US and A right now. Will Ferrell’s icy laugh-a-thon nabbed $14 million in its third week of release, for a healthy $90 million total to date.
